How To Use Google Sitemaps With WordPress

A website sitemap is an important part of your websites SEO (search engine optimization) plan as it allows for search engine spiders (like Googlebot) to quickly and easily find new posts and pages that you have added to your WordPress blog or website. The easier it is for the search engines to find new content the better chance you have of getting that content indexed in those search engines and at a much faster rate.

A sitemap is simply an index of all the pages and posts on your website. Basically it looks like a long list of links with one link going to each of your pages. Now it's a real pain in the butt to do this by hand so be thankful for a fantastic free WordPress Plugin called Google XML Sitemaps. Get over to the WordPress Plugin Directory and install it in your WordPress site.

When you first check out the settings on the Google XML Sitemap plugin it may be a bit overwhelming but don't worry about it at first. For the vast majority of WordPress sites, at least when they are new, the default settings are going to be totally fine. Just leave them for now.

You do have to take one action however to get it going. When you install the plugin for the first time you have to click a link at the top of the settings page to create the sitemap for the first time. It will tell you, right there at the top, that your sitemap has not been created yet and provide you a link to click. Go ahead and click it. Pretty easy right? So after the first time you generate a sitemap you can pretty much go hands off. Every time you create a new page or post it will automatically add them to the sitemap. At the same time it will ping (or alert) the major search engines that you have new content that they should come over and crawl. All of this happens in the background and you don't have to worry about it for a second.

Another very cool feature is that even when you just change, add to or modify a post or page on your WordPress site the sitemap will update as well. Sweet, right?

The only other thing you should do is create a link in the footer of your site to the sitemap. This way no matter what page a search engine spider happens to find first it will always find your site map and therefore all of your other pages and posts. Get to it!

Discover the XML - Sitemap Plugin For Wordpress

Any time you build a website or blog, If you want to get some visitors to find it, you need to let Google and the other search engines know its there. Now for Wordpress there is a plugin called XML-Sitemaps.

With the XML-Sitemaps plugin, you just set it up once and each time you post to your blog it automatically rebuilds your sitemap and notifies Google, Yahoo, MSN, and Ask.com.

To set it all up, you first have to download it from the Wordpress site.

After you install it by placing it in your plugins directory, you first have to go to the plugins page in the back office of your wordpress installation and activate it.

After its activated, click on settings, then click the XML-Sitemaps Tab at the top.

Now this is where you set it all up. If you scroll down the page a bit to where it says Basic Options, a little more down the page you will see that Yahoo is unchecked. You will need a special developer code to use this. Don't worry if you're not a developer. Yahoo will give you the code so just go ahead and click the link and get your developer code to put in the box next to notify Yahoo. Then check the Yahoo box and save your update.

A little further down you will see a section called Location of your sitemap file. Here is where you tell the sitemap generator where to find your sitemap file. If none is there you will need to create a blank file and place it where you want it, then put the location of the file in the box.

Down further towards the bottom, you will see a section called Sitemap content. Make sure all those are checked. You want the search engines to index all your content, including comments, pages, posts, and the tag pages where your posts associated with each tag show.

When you're done, just scroll back up to Status section at the top and click where it says Rebuild the sitemap manually. If all goes well it will rebuild your sitemap and notify the 4 search engines.

Now each time you publish a post, your sitemap will be overwritten and all 4 search engines will be notified. Eventually your blog will start to get indexed, and it doesn't take long.

For anyone new to blogging and website creation, getting indexed means more traffic and visitors to your blog since people will find your blog in search results.

I hope this helps anyone who had questions about xml-sitemaps for wordpress.

In the previous article I showed how to create a HTML WordPress sitemap that would help your visitors to browse your site and find your previous posts. In this article I will show how to create a WordPress XML sitemap which will help search engine spiders crawl your site so that all of your pages can get indexed.

A WordPress XML sitemap is basically a file that has all of the URL's to all of your pages and posts listed along with some additional data (such as when it was last updated). This file won't make sense to the average user but makes perfect sense to the search engines and will help your blog to rank with them.

So let's get started. First, go to your WordPress dashboard and then click on Add New under Plugins.

The plugin we are looking for is Google XML Sitemaps by Arne Brachhold. So search for Google XML Sitemaps and it should be the top result. Click on Install on the right hand side and then activate the plugin.

Go back to the Plugins page and look for the newly installed Google XML Sitemaps plugin. When you have found it, click on the settings link.

For most blogger's needs the standard settings will be fine but you can change the settings to what you think will be more suitable for your blog. You can go to the plugin site for help or do a Google search.

Make sure Rebuild sitemap if you change the content of your blog is checked so that it updates automatically. Once you've chosen your settings click on Rebuild sitemap to create your sitemap for the first time.

And that's pretty much it. The sitemap should be located at yourURL.com/sitemap.XML, so to check that your WordPress XML sitemap has been created just go to that address.

Top Six Essential Plugins For WordPress Beginners

One of the most dominant blog publishing and content management application up-to-date is WordPress, with over 25 million users across the globe. An open source CMS that is free of charge. Website owners and bloggers can conveniently visit the official WordPress website for free application and plugins downloads.

Fundamentally, WordPress started as a blog engine. Thanks to the diligence and skills of thousands of volunteers and coders who developed WordPress, users can now the application's features to chance a static unexciting page into a fully dynamic customized web page in just a couple of mouse clicks. That is the main reason why WordPress is gaining its fame among the millions of web designers, organizations and businesses throughout the world.

WordPress authoritative feature ranges from a user friendly template driven system, workflow area, category allocation and more. With that said, the most wonderful thing about WordPress is that users can execute plug-ins for their specified website functionality and needs.

WordPress plugins make modification and customization simple. It is a program that accommodates diverse specifications and requirements. Likewise, it is not difficult to actualize particularly for beginners or users who are unfamiliar with web design codes such as html and php.

Here are the top 6 recommended WordPress plugins that are free to download and essential for your new blog site:

Akismet - This plugin is very beneficial to control and fight spam on your blog site. Spammers who leave comments and links to promote their sites are often offensive. Truly, a time - conserving plugin. A must for all blog sites.

All in One SEO Pack - It is one of the most commonly used plugins among SEO practitioners. Its fundamental function is to turn your posts and pages to be more search engine friendly so that you can rank higher on search results that are appropriate to your content posted. To increase traffic to website, this plugin is utilized by blog and website owners.

XML Sitemaps - This plugin automatically generates XML sitemaps for your website and gives notification to search engines when they are updated. The main purpose is to make your blog posts more search engines friendly so that they can be easily crawled and indexed, thus enabling people to find them on major search engines.

Broken Link Checker - This practical plugin can administer checking of outgoing links. It also eliminates dead links. Dead links are listed out because it will negatively have an effect on the website's search engine ranking.

StatPress Reloaded - This useful plugin is used to track the visitor's of the website. Furthermore, it provides the number of page views, spiders and RSS feeds.

SEO Smart Links - Many SEO practitioners believe in the practical use of back links. With this plugin, linking an article to another article is achievable. Moreover, this is also helpful for bloggers who want their visitors to find articles on similar subjects since this plugin interlinks the keyword automatically.

Digg Digg Social Sharing - This plugin that is accountable for the floating social icon found at the left side corner of each post. It provides user easy access to Twitter icon, thus making it easier for readers to share and endorse content.
